# LangChain Upgrade Migration ## Overview Guide for upgrading LangChain versions safely with migration strategies for breaking changes. ## Prerequisites - Existing LangChain application - Version control with current code committed - Test suite covering core functionality - Staging environment for validation ## Instructions ### Step 1: Check Current Versions ```bash pip show langchain langchain-core langchain-openai langchain-community # Output current requirements pip freeze | grep -i langchain > langchain_current.txt ``` ### Step 2: Review Breaking Changes ```python # Key breaking changes by version: # 0.1.x -> 0.2.x (Major restructuring) # - langchain-core extracted as separate package # - Imports changed from langchain.* to langchain_core.* # - ChatModels moved to provider packages # 0.2.x -> 0.3.x (LCEL standardization) # - Legacy chains deprecated # - AgentExecutor changes # - Memory API updates # Check migration guides: # https://python.langchain.com/docs/versions/migrating_chains/ ``` ### Step 3: Update Import Paths ```python # OLD (pre-0.2): from langchain.chat_models import ChatOpenAI from langchain.prompts import ChatPromptTemplate from langchain.chains import LLMChain # NEW (0.3+): from langchain_openai import ChatOpenAI from langchain_core.prompts import ChatPromptTemplate from langchain_core.output_parsers import StrOutputParser # Migration script import re def migrate_imports(content: str) -> str: """Migrate old imports to new pattern.""" migrations = [ (r"from langchain\.chat_models import ChatOpenAI", "from langchain_openai import ChatOpenAI"), (r"from langchain\.llms import OpenAI", "from langchain_openai import OpenAI"), (r"from langchain\.prompts import", "from langchain_core.prompts import"), (r"from langchain\.schema import", "from langchain_core.messages import"), (r"from langchain\.callbacks import", "from langchain_core.callbacks import"), ] for old, new in migrations: content = re.sub(old, new, content) return content ``` ### Step 4: Migrate Legacy Chains to LCEL ```python # OLD: LLMChain (deprecated) from langchain.chains import LLMChain chain = LLMChain(llm=llm, prompt=prompt) result = chain.run(input="hello") # NEW: LCEL (LangChain Expression Language) from langchain_core.output_parsers import StrOutputParser chain = prompt | llm | StrOutputParser() result = chain.invoke({"input": "hello"}) ``` ### Step 5: Migrate Agents ```python # OLD: initialize_agent (deprecated) from langchain.agents import initialize_agent, AgentType agent = initialize_agent( tools=tools, llm=llm, agent=AgentType.ZERO_SHOT_REACT_DESCRIPTION ) # NEW: create_tool_calling_agent from langchain.agents import create_tool_calling_agent, AgentExecutor from langchain_core.prompts import ChatPromptTemplate, MessagesPlaceholder prompt = ChatPromptTemplate.from_messages([ ("system", "You are a helpful assistant."), ("human", "{input}"), MessagesPlaceholder(variable_name="agent_scratchpad"), ]) agent = create_tool_calling_agent(llm, tools, prompt) agent_executor = AgentExecutor(agent=agent, tools=tools) ``` ### Step 6: Migrate Memory ```python # OLD: ConversationBufferMemory from langchain.memory import ConversationBufferMemory memory = ConversationBufferMemory() chain = LLMChain(llm=llm, prompt=prompt, memory=memory) # NEW: RunnableWithMessageHistory from langchain_core.chat_history import BaseChatMessageHistory from langchain_core.runnables.history import RunnableWithMessageHistory from langchain_community.chat_message_histories import ChatMessageHistory store = {} def get_session_history(session_id: str) -> BaseChatMessageHistory: if session_id not in store: store[session_id] = ChatMessageHistory() return store[session_id] chain_with_history = RunnableWithMessageHistory( chain, get_session_history, input_messages_key="input", history_messages_key="history" ) ``` ### Step 7: Upgrade Packages ```bash # Create backup of current environment pip freeze > requirements_backup.txt # Upgrade to latest stable pip install --upgrade langchain langchain-core langchain-openai langchain-community # Or specific version pip install langchain==0.3.0 langchain-core==0.3.0 # Verify versions pip show langchain langchain-core ``` ### Step 8: Run Tests ```bash # Run test suite pytest tests/ -v # Check for deprecation warnings pytest tests/ -W error::DeprecationWarning # Run type checking mypy src/ ``` ## Migration Checklist - [ ] Current version documented - [ ] Breaking changes reviewed - [ ] Imports updated - [ ] LLMChain -> LCEL migrated - [ ] Agent initialization updated - [ ] Memory patterns updated - [ ] Tests passing - [ ] Staging validation complete ## Error Handling | Error | Cause | Solution | |-------|-------|----------| | ImportError | Old import path | Update to new package imports | | AttributeError | Removed method | Check migration guide for replacement | | DeprecationWarning | Using old API | Migrate to new pattern | | TypeErrror | Changed signature | Update function arguments | ## Resources -
